Android 2.3.4 Gingerbread ROM for HTC Thunderbolt

Late yesterday, Gingerbread ROM file has leaked online for HTC Thunderbolt smartphone, but it wasn’t flashable. A guy named Justin Case has made some changes to it, and released the flashable Gingerbread ROM, and you can download it from below. The release of this matches up perfectly to the news HTC broke through us back in March that Android 2.3 would be rolling out Thunderbolt owners before the end of Q2 of this year, that means before the end of June.

The guys who want to try this Gingerbread ROM on their Thunderbolt handsets, should note a thing that camera will not work after flashing this ROM. This ROM works for rooted devices only.

Instructions

  • Thunderbolt owners can download both the ROM (0ba18ca101a0295df37bba36b562d210) and the radio (52dd83aa40e30186c9fbefafd1bab534).

Rename PG05IMG_gingerradio.zip to PG05IMG.zip –> Copy it onto the root of your SD Card –> Place mecha_gingerjane.zip onto the root of your SD Card –> Boot into recovery –> Do a Nandroid Backup –> Perform a factory reset –> Flash mecha_gingerjane.zip –> Reboot to bootloader using ADB –> Switch to bootloader mode and allow the updated radios to flash –> Finish.

  • If the zip you downloaded from above is version 1.2, you’ll also have to flash this file to fix activation. Head over to the source link below for full fledged instructions regarding this Gingerbread ROM for Thunderbolt handsets.
